Car Keys
This one has already been developing over the last few years but it is sure to gain more and more traction with big pushes coming from companies like Apple and Google. Thanks to NFC and UWB technologies (and of course the OGs of wireless connectively Bluetooth and mobile data) we can use out smartphones for all sorts of new and exciting things. Not only are near field communications incredibly convenient but they also serve a useful function. I believe over the next couple of years we’ll start to see more and more people either unlocking their car remotely with their phones or perhaps just not having physical keys anymore and relying on near field connections to unlock your car as long as your phone is in your pocket!
